No does not mean you can't do it.
When someone tells you “no” it does not mean you can't do it. It means you can't do it with them. Onboarding people onto your vision needs effort and convincing. Also sharing same goal and finding right fit people to join you on your journey is rare. Hence it is important to not take each 'no' as a lack of your ability.
Mindset shift required to process a 'No'
Its not about you. It is not a reflection of you abilities. Sometimes situations, priorities, and timing is not aligned with your goals.
There isn't ONE path. Look for alternatives, there are more than one ways to achieve your goal. Explore your options.
Lean in and learn. Think what you could have done differently. Change your approach, practice, and improve your next shot taking it closer to success.
If someone tells you "no," it means that they are not the right fit for your goal or vision now. And it's ok. This can be a valuable opportunity to re-evaluate your approach and explore other options or opportunities. It's important to maintain a growth mindset and not let a rejection hold you back. Don't let no stop you from pursuing your dreams and goals. March forward to explore new ways of achieving them. You've got this!

Stop hanging out with Idiots.
I am a nerd, have always been a nerd. All through out my school, college I liked books, liked to study, and I liked exams. cringe. I know. I studied in all girls high-school. Yes, it was brutal, but I survived. One day few of my friends decided that I shouldn't hang out with them because it makes them look 'uncool'. It hurt at first. But it was damn cool to not have constant negativity, and dumbness around. While I was leading games club, playing badminton games at state level, and writing school newspaper, so-called cool gang was flunking high school. Life lesson I learned early on to choose company around me intentionally and stay away from idiots stayed with me.
We all know when we are surrounded by idiots. They are disrespectful, closed minded, lack empathy, and have no self awareness. Obviously all decisions around them are self-centered and lack thinking.
Thinking and decision making are critical life skills needed for success & growth. It is simple. You strive to be better with a good company by making good decisions, and bring yourself down with bad decisions, with a bad company.
Chose your social circle to be kind, open minded, and smart. Your world would be more uplifting. #LifeHack
